Thinking routines

Thinking routines are simple, structured strategies that help individuals consciously engage with their thinking process. They serve as tools to encourage curiosity, deepen understanding, and promote reflection during learning or problem-solving. By guiding attention and organizing thoughts, these routines support critical thinking and collaborative discussion. Think of them as mental frameworks or prompts that make thinking more deliberate and manageable, fostering clearer insight and more thoughtful responses. They are widely used in education and creative settings to cultivate purposeful, active engagement with ideas.
